The UPD78CP14G is a microcontroller from NEC (now Renesas Electronics) belonging to the 78K/0 series. This microcontroller is designed for a wide range of embedded applications, offering a balance of processing power and low-power consumption.

Features
- 8-bit CPU: The core of the microcontroller is an 8-bit processor providing sufficient processing power for many embedded tasks.
- On-Chip Memory: Includes Flash memory for program storage and RAM for data storage, varying in size based on specific versions of the microcontroller.
- Timers and Counters: Equipped with multiple timers and counters for precise timing control and event counting.
- Serial Communication Interfaces: Supports UART, SPI, and I2C interfaces for communication with other devices.
- Analog-to-Digital Converter (ADC): Incorporates an ADC for converting analog signals to digital values, allowing the microcontroller to interface with sensors and other analog devices.
- Interrupt Controller: Manages interrupt requests from various peripherals, enabling responsive handling of real-time events.
- Low-Power Modes: Offers multiple low-power modes to minimize power consumption in battery-powered applications.

Additional Details
The UPD78CP14G operates on a supply voltage of typically 5V. It is available in various package options, including QFP and DIP. The microcontroller's instruction set is optimized for efficient code execution, contributing to its overall performance. Specific features, such as memory size, clock speed, and number of I/O pins, depend on the particular variant of the UPD78CP14G.
